it's featured on the itunes front page in both countries. in the us it's listed on both the 'hot tracks' and '69¢ songs' sections, both of which are known to give sizeable boosts to both new and old songs.

presumably this is all part of bad boy's promo for its apple music-exclusive movie which has taken up all the banners on the front page. three other bad boy tracks are on the 'hot tracks' front page along w/ "me & u", and if you check you'll notice all of those are also high on the itunes charts now.
